Evil Hat Productions has announced several personnel moves effective immediately. Leonard Balsera is leaving his position as Fate Line Developer to spend more time at his positions of COO and Creative Director at John Wick Presents. Balsera will continue to work with Evil Hat on individual projects. He was lead developer on Dresden Files Accelerated and Fate Core, and worked on the original Dresden Files RPG.
Balsera will be replaced by Sophie Lagace, who has been project managing Fate projects and will now become Fate Line Developer.
Separately, Brian Patterson has been promoted from Art Director to Senior Art Director. In that position he’ll add some supervisory tasks to his role.
